Civil and Administrative Tribunal New South Wales Medium Neutral Citation: CSK v Secretary, Department of Family and Community Services [2017] NSWCATAP 85 Hearing dates: On the papers Date of orders: 21 April 2017 Decision date: 21 April 2017 Jurisdiction: Appeal Panel Before: K O'Connor, AM, ADCJ,Deputy President, Appeals J Lucy, Senior Member Decision: Appeal dismissed Catchwords: ADMINISTRATIVE REVIEW – Jurisdiction – Decision to decline to assess suitability of prospective adoptive parents to adopt child. – Whether decision externally reviewable by Tribunal – Tribunal held not – appeal dismissed. Legislation Cited: Administrative Review Decisions Act 1997 Adoption Act 2000 Adoption Regulation 2015 Civil and Administrative Tribunal Act 2013 Cases Cited: BWO and BWP v Barnardos Australia [2015] NSWCATAD 216 BY v Director General, Attorney General's Department [2002] NSWADT 79 Category: Principal judgment Parties: CSK (First Appellant) CSL (Second Appellant) Secretary, Department of Family and Community Services (Respondent) File Number(s): 16/55539 Publication restriction: Section 65(1)(b) and (2) of the Civil and Administrative Tribunal Act 2013 apply to these proceedings. Decision under appeal Court or tribunal: Civil and Administrative Tribunal Jurisdiction: Administrative and Equal Opportunity Division Citation: CSK v Secretary, Department of Family and Community Services [2016] NSWCATAD 292 Date of Decision: 14 December 2016 Before: S Higgins, Principal Member File Number(s): 1610578
